When it comes to choosing between Harchand Ballav Technical Institute (HBTI) and University School of Information Technology (USIT) Delhi, the decision leans heavily towards HBTI. Established in 1921, HBTI is one of the oldest engineering institutes in India and Asia, offering unparalleled educational and career opportunities.

HBTI: The Leader in Engineering Education

HBTI is a noteworthy brand in the realm of engineering education. With a rich history dating back to 1921, the institute has pioneered several domains of chemical engineering, setting a benchmark in the field. As one of the top engineering colleges in India, HBTI consistently ranks among the top 30–40 institutions in the country. What truly sets HBTI apart is its status as a top choice for students with excellent entrance ranks, ensuring a high-quality learning environment and excellent placement prospects.

Alumni Network: The alumni network of HBTI is extensive and impressive, featuring a roster of distinguished civil servants, scientists, engineers, and Indian Engineering Services (IES) officers. This network provides a valuable resource for students seeking mentorship and professional networking opportunities, further enhancing their career prospects.

USIT: A Solid Option but Not as Outstanding

USIT, while part of Guru Ghasidas Vishwavidyalaya (GGSIPU) in Delhi, is generally regarded as an average academic institute from an engineering standpoint. Although students who join USIT often achieve good ranks in IPUCET entrances, the academic experience does not match that of HBTI. Placements are generally average, with only a few leading companies visiting the campus for recruitment. The alumni network of USIT is also less substantial compared to HBTI.

Establishment and Location: USIT, established in 1998 and located in Dwarka, has a smaller campus size compared to HBTI's expansive 300 acres. While USIT's surroundings and quality of life might be better, campus life at HBTI offers a richer experience for students.

Placement Outcomes and Student Preferences

When it comes to placements, HBTI currently outperforms USIT. The majority of placements in Computer Science and Information Technology (CSE and IT) streams in USIT range from 3.5 to 5.5 lakhs per annum (LPA). Core companies, particularly in Electrical and Electronics Engineering (ECE) streams, are less likely to visit USIT for campus placements.

Choosing the Right Institute: For students who are Delhiites or from the National Capital Region (NCR), USIT presents a great option. However, individuals from mainland Uttar Pradesh (UP) would benefit more from the extensive resources and placements offered by HBTI.
